5 个解决方案
#1
为什么要这样设计呢。。。。
关联一下就可以了啊。。
关联一下就可以了啊。。
#2
先查询第一个表的值 然后在把查询的值返回插入到另外一个表中
比如
sql="select * from 表1"
rs.open sql,conn,1,1
id=rs("id")
name=rs("name")
sql1="select * from 表2"
rs1.open sql,conn,1,3
rs1.addnew
id1=rs("id1")
ts1("name")=name
yy.update
比如
sql="select * from 表1"
rs.open sql,conn,1,1
id=rs("id")
name=rs("name")
sql1="select * from 表2"
rs1.open sql,conn,1,3
rs1.addnew
id1=rs("id1")
ts1("name")=name
yy.update
#3
你这设计,汗颜...
那你成绩表也要有家庭住址这些字段
那你点击学籍号的时候查出学生信息,再根据这学籍号
把相应字段插入成绩表..
那你成绩表也要有家庭住址这些字段
那你点击学籍号的时候查出学生信息,再根据这学籍号
把相应字段插入成绩表..
#4
关联表就可以了,找到共同字段,不用设计那么复杂吧
#5
insert into A () select * from B
#1
为什么要这样设计呢。。。。
关联一下就可以了啊。。
关联一下就可以了啊。。
#2
先查询第一个表的值 然后在把查询的值返回插入到另外一个表中
比如
sql="select * from 表1"
rs.open sql,conn,1,1
id=rs("id")
name=rs("name")
sql1="select * from 表2"
rs1.open sql,conn,1,3
rs1.addnew
id1=rs("id1")
ts1("name")=name
yy.update
比如
sql="select * from 表1"
rs.open sql,conn,1,1
id=rs("id")
name=rs("name")
sql1="select * from 表2"
rs1.open sql,conn,1,3
rs1.addnew
id1=rs("id1")
ts1("name")=name
yy.update
#3
你这设计,汗颜...
那你成绩表也要有家庭住址这些字段
那你点击学籍号的时候查出学生信息,再根据这学籍号
把相应字段插入成绩表..
那你成绩表也要有家庭住址这些字段
那你点击学籍号的时候查出学生信息,再根据这学籍号
把相应字段插入成绩表..
#4
关联表就可以了,找到共同字段,不用设计那么复杂吧
#5
insert into A () select * from B